Post comment/reviewWhat is MergeSVG?
Combine SVGs like a designer: free-form drag & drop, pixel-perfect alignment, deep styling, and one-click merge.
After adding SVG badges and illustrations to my GitHub README, I often saw empty gaps when remote assets failed to load. Moreover, README’s limited Markdown makes it hard to get banner layouts to look exactly the way I want. So I built MergeSVG: a browser-based, drag-and-drop tool that merges SVGs into a single, self-contained file and lets you position and style graphics visually. In conclusion, your README will always appear exactly as you designed it.
Features:
- Design freedom without Markdown limitations — No markdown or HTML syntax required; design intuitively with drag & drop.
- Customizable canvas background — Control background color, transparency, and patterns (grid, dots, checkerboard).
- Real-time preview — See your composition as you build it.
- One-click export — Download your merged SVG instantly.
- Client-side processing — Fast, secure, and private—everything runs in your browser.
- No more broken links — The app embeds raw SVG content into a single file so external resources can’t break your layout.
